🔍 Understanding HPMC K4M Molecular Weight: The Science Behind Your Success
Hydroxypropyl Methylcellulose (HPMC) K4M is a non-ionic cellulose ether with a molecular weight (MW) range of 80,000–120,000 g/mol. This specific grade is engineered for high viscosity applications where controlled thickening, water retention, and film formation are critical.
📊 What Does Molecular Weight Mean for Your Applications?
Molecular weight (MW) dictates performance:
- Viscosity: Higher MW = thicker gels (e.g., K4M’s 80,000–120,000 g/mol range delivers 4,000–6,000 mPa·s viscosity at 2% concentration).
- Water Retention: Optimal MW ensures minimal water evaporation in cementitious systems (e.g., tile adhesives, renders).
- Film Formation: Balanced MW creates flexible, crack-resistant films in pharmaceutical coatings and paints.
- Thermal Stability: MW stability prevents gelation at high temperatures (critical for hot-mix applications).

2. How does molecular weight affect dissolution time in pharmaceuticals?
Higher MW slows dissolution due to longer polymer chains. For pharma:
- MW 80,000–90,000 g/mol: Dissolves in 20–30 minutes (ideal for tablet coating).
- MW >100,000 g/mol: May require 45+ minutes or heat-assisted dissolution.

7. How does HPMC K4M compare to other grades like K15M or K100M?
| Grade | MW Range (g/mol) | Viscosity (2%, mPa·s) | Best For | Price (USD/kg) |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| K4M | 80,000–120,000 | 4,000–6,000 | Mid-high viscosity, balanced performance | $3.80–$5.50 |
| K15M | 150,000–200,000 | 15,000–20,000 | Ultra-high viscosity, thickeners | $5.20–$6.80 |
| K100M | 1,000,000+ | 80,000+ | Specialty applications (e.g., oil drilling) | $8.50–$12.00 |
